Author:  hari [ Mon Feb 02, 2009 9:53 pm ]
Post subject:  [SOLVED (?)] Can't playback CBS HD?

This only started a week or so ago. Craig Ferguson will crash mythfrontend, but David Letterman, recorded on the same HD channel with the same HD tuner (HD HomeRun) plays normally. Tonight, "Big Bang Theory" will not play, with the error

2009-02-02 20:53:38.452 [mpegvideo_xvmc @ 0xb7245e68]get_buffer() failed (1 1073741824 2 (nil))
2009-02-02 20:53:38.452 AFD Error: Unknown decoding error

However, I can run mythfrontend on a MacBook and watch both Craig Ferguson and Big Bang Theory. Other HD channels are fine on the Knoppmyth box.

This is a strange problem, and I'm sorry I can't give any more details, but I can't think of why one channel is behaving like this, and why Linux can't play it while it works on a Mac.

If anyone has any suggestions where to start digging I would love to try.

Thanks!

Author:  tjc [ Mon Feb 02, 2009 11:57 pm ]
Post subject: 

There was some weirdness depending on resolution you might want to search for. Something like 1080i working but not 720p. First use mplayer or the like to check the resolution and the like on the different recordings and find out if there is a difference... (If you run mplayer from the command line it reports the recording tech specs. for a recording)

Author:  hari [ Tue Feb 03, 2009 7:17 am ]
Post subject: 

If I log in remotely, export DISPLAY=:0, and run mplayer, the recording looks and sounds fine! Playing from the mythtv recordings menu does not work. I recorded Leno and Letterman last night. Leno plays from mythtv, Letterman does not.

The only things I can see differently are the reported bit rate - Leno shows 65000 kbps, which looks like a default value, Letterman shows 15600, which looks reasonable. This is probably not important.

When I play a CBS show, I get these error messages from the command line mplayer, but I can watch the show and it looks fine:

Code:
[mpeg2video @ 0x888bc30]end mismatch left=1176 48D6C7%  0%  2.8% 0 0
[mpeg2video @ 0x888bc30]Warning MVs not available
[mpeg2video @ 0x888bc30]concealing 120 DC, 120 AC, 120 MV errors


So I poked around the setup screens and I found that my playback profile was set to CPU+, which uses xvmc. I switched to Normal and now my CBS shows play again!

In /var/log/mythfrontend.log I still get these messages with a CBS show:
Code:
2009-02-03 07:01:56.732 [mpeg2video @ 0xb7245e68]Warning MVs not available
2009-02-03 07:02:02.504 [mpeg2video @ 0xb7245e68]Warning MVs not available


I don't see these on non-CBS shows. Anyway, thank you for the suggestion! I wouldn't have known where to start looking!

Author:  ceenvee703 [ Tue Feb 03, 2009 8:07 am ]
Post subject: 

Well, either you jinxed me, MythTV hates Big Bang Theory, or something's weird about how XvMC plays it back.

Read your message this morning, then went down to walk on the treadmill and watch shows from my remote frontend (an old Athlon 2400+ which needs XvMC to play back HD).

24 (Fox, 720p) played back fine. Big Bang Theory (CBS, 1080i) crashed the frontend every single time.

Moreover, if I selected Live TV, I could watch Fox and ABC (720p), I could watch NBC (1080i), but if I tuned to CBS, the frontend crashed out to the desktop.

I could watch Big Bang Theory on the MythTV front end I have on my Ubuntu 8.10 system, but that's got enough horsepower that it doesn't require XvMC.

Haven't had a chance to look at any logs yet, will report back when I do.
